Announced workforce reductions and restructurings across pharma, biotech, MedTech and CROs — with the scale, region and context of each event, and a link to the primary source. A picture of where the industry is tightening.
| Company | Announced | Scale | Region | Type | Context | Source |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Takeda | May 2025 | — | Global | Pharma | Efficiency programme streamlining operations across R&D and commercial functions. | Source ↗ |
| Bristol Myers Squibb | Apr 2025 | 6,000 | Global | Pharma | Expanded cost-savings programme targeting ~$2bn in additional savings by 2027, cutting roles across the organisation. | Source ↗ |
| Bayer | Mar 2025 | — | Global | Pharma | Continued restructuring under its "Dynamic Shared Ownership" model, reducing management layers and headcount across pharma and crop science. | Source ↗ |
| Novartis | Feb 2025 | — | Global | Pharma | Ongoing structural simplification following its "pure-play" pharma pivot and Sandoz spin-off. | Source ↗ |
| Pfizer | Jan 2025 | — | Global | Pharma | Second phase of a multi-year cost-realignment programme aiming for billions in net savings after the post-COVID revenue decline. | Source ↗ |
| Roche | Nov 2024 | — | Global | Pharma | Pipeline reprioritisation with associated headcount impacts in pharma and diagnostics. | Source ↗ |
| Sanofi | Oct 2024 | — | Global | Pharma | Reorganisation tied to the planned separation of its consumer-health business (Opella). | Source ↗ |
| Moderna | Sep 2024 | — | USA | Biotech | Announced R&D spending cuts of ~$1.1bn by 2027 amid lower COVID revenue. | Source ↗ |
| Charles River Laboratories | Aug 2024 | — | Global | CRO | Cost-cutting including site consolidations amid softer early-stage biotech demand. | Source ↗ |
| Bristol Myers Squibb | Jul 2024 | 2,200 | Global | Pharma | Initial phase of a strategic productivity initiative announced with Q2 results. | Source ↗ |
| Miltenyi Biotec | Jun 2024 | — | Germany | Biotech | Workforce reductions reported amid a broader life-science tools slowdown. | Source ↗ |
| Novavax | May 2024 | — | USA | Biotech | Restructuring to cut R&D and G&A spend after COVID-vaccine demand fell. | Source ↗ |
| Illumina | Apr 2024 | — | USA | MedTech | Restructuring following the GRAIL divestiture, cutting operating costs. | Source ↗ |
| GSK | Mar 2024 | — | Global | Pharma | Selective role reductions as part of ongoing commercial and R&D prioritisation. | Source ↗ |
| Biogen | Feb 2024 | — | USA | Biotech | Continued "Fit for Growth" programme targeting ~$1bn gross savings. | Source ↗ |
| Thermo Fisher Scientific | Feb 2024 | — | Global | MedTech | Ongoing cost realignment as pandemic-era testing and bioprocessing demand normalised. | Source ↗ |
| Amgen | Jan 2024 | — | USA | Biotech | Site and role rationalisation following the Horizon Therapeutics acquisition. | Source ↗ |
| Bayer | Jan 2024 | — | Germany | Pharma | Announced significant management-layer reductions as part of organisational overhaul. | Source ↗ |
Editorially maintained from public company statements, regulatory (WARN) notices and major trade-press reporting; each row links to a primary source. Where a company discloses no headcount figure, the scale column shows "—". "Disclosed roles affected" sums only events with a public number, so the real total is higher.
